Can ppl with a sulfa allergy go to Yellowstone? by Mayor-of-Toontown in Allergies

[–]Vaneryx 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Those with SIBO generally have issues with FODMAPs, specific types of carbs. Fructans are generally the worst type of FODMAP and include garlic, onions and wheat. So you likely have a fructan intolerance, BUT if you have the third type of SIBO (hydrogen sulfide), it will make you a lot more sensitive to foods with sulphur as well

Pregnant with migraines and I feel so hopeless! I’m tired of band aid solutions please help! by Electrical_Jelly_145 in moderatelygranolamoms

[–]Vaneryx 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Hydroxyzine is prescribed generally for anxiety, however it’s really classified as an antihistamine so that’s why it works.

Electrical_Jelly - I suffer with the same cluster of issues…migraines, allergies and sinus issues (as well as gut issues). The only long term solution I’ve found is to lower the amount of high histamine foods I eat. I am by no means recommending a diet, esp during pregnancy, but I recommend looking at a list of high histamine foods, seeing if it’s something you eat often, and perhaps reducing it. The list here is published by John Hopkins medicine and i strongly recommend taking a look!

Obviously, with pregnancy there will be fluctuations in hormones as well and when your estrogen is elevated so is histamine.

Please look into the connection between histamine and migraines - there are many studies on it, but please don’t be alarmed, histamine is not bad- it’s a necessary neurotransmitter/neuromodulator, just some folks are better at processing it than others!
